Dahlgren devised a family of shell guns and howitzers—commonly called Dahlgren guns—ranging from 9-pounder boat guns to heavy smoothbores mounted on warships. His designs emphasized a distinctive bottle-shaped casting with reinforced breech, inspired by failures that had occurred on guns tested at sites like Watertown Arsenal and in actions near Fort Sumter. The guns were produced in foundries in Pittsburgh, Brooklyn, Springfield Armory, and private firms supplying the Union Navy and were installed on ironclads such as USS Monitor, frigates including USS Wabash, and gunboats like USS Cayuga.
